GNSS Receivers: Modern Solutions for Geodesy and Precise Measurements<\/h3>\r\nGNSS receivers play an important role in surveying and engineering projects, providing highly accurate data on the location of objects on the ground. These devices use signals from global navigation satellite systems to determine coordinates, making them indispensable tools for construction, mapping, and monitoring of territories.\r\n

What is a GNSS receiver?<\/h4>\r\nA GNSS receiver is a device that receives signals from satellites such as GPS, GLONASS, Galileo, and BeiDou and processes them to obtain precise coordinates on Earth. Geodetic GNSS receivers provide the most accurate measurements and are widely used in engineering and scientific projects.\r\n
